## Release Checklist — Duskrunner Backfill Scheduler

Before cutting a Duskrunner release, double-check the nightly backfill schedule config is frozen; last quarter we shipped with a dev cron and reprocessed three days of data twice. Confirm the scheduler image was built by the Pinloft pipeline and that the provenance attestation verifies cleanly — future you will thank present you. Once verification passes, paste the result into the release notes. Record the build token, which appears below.

pipeline stamp: htk31_f769b577b3028a4e9958e5bb8d1259a

# Webhook Retry Semantics — Artifact Signing (Farrowgate)

For eng sync. Signed-artifact webhooks from Farrowgate retry on 5xx and timeouts only. Backoff: 30s, 2m, 10m, 1h, then dead-letter. 4xx responses are terminal — no retry. Delivery is at-least-once; consumers must dedupe on event ID. Signature verification failures count as terminal. Dead-lettered events replayable for 7 days via the ops console. Receivers verify payloads against the publishing key. The current publishing key is below.

rollout seal: bky9_dKu6BZbvE

## Migrating off the legacy queue

We're replacing the homegrown Crankshaft job queue with Relayline. Symptoms of Crankshaft trouble: jobs stuck in 'claimed' with no worker heartbeat. Fix: drain the shard, replay from the ledger. Don't patch Crankshaft — all new work goes to Relayline. New hires: test replays only in the sandbox. Sandbox replay calls authenticate with the token below.

portal login ticket: eyJhbGciOiJIUzI1NiIsInR5cCI6IkpXVCJ9.eyJzdWIiOiIwEOsktwVNwIn0.-UJU3fdyyCgG

Title: Fleet fuel-usage report double-counts transfers

The weekly fuel report for the Ardenfell depot fleet counts inter-depot fuel transfers as consumption, inflating totals by roughly 8%. New contractor: please check the aggregation query's join on transfer records before touching the reporting layer. Reproduces on the March dataset every run. The report generation run exhibiting this is traced by the token below.

session token of tajef-bageg = htk21_5d90d574934f3ccae6437